Real simple but happens often: I am trying to print from an excel spreadsheet. I do all the steps as asked for uin the instructions, but when I print, it prints the first record by itself on one pahe of paper, then the second record on a second piece of paper by itself. Obviously, i want 20 different records on ione sheet of paper.

Hi muckrayk,
Evidently you're using a 'letter' merge. For your purposes, you need to use either a label merge or a directory/catalogue merge.
